South Korea visa requirements for citizens of Canada.

eTA requiredStays of up to 180 days per visit.We can submit this for you

No visa — but citizens of Canada typically need an electronic travel authorisation (eTA) for South Korea, applied for online before travel; stays of up to 180 days are typically allowed.

K-ETA; exemption extended to 31 Dec 2026

How to get: Valid passport

Apply for or renew your passport at your country's passport authority (often the foreign-affairs or interior ministry, a passport office or designated post office). Most visa portals want a clear colour scan of the bio-data page; keep the passport valid at least 6 months beyond your trip with two blank pages.

How to get: Passport bio-page photo

Have a recent passport photo taken at a pharmacy, photo booth or photographer, or use a compliant online photo tool. The common size is 35×45 mm with a plain light background, neutral expression and no glasses; the US and a few others require 2×2 in (51×51 mm). Get 2–4 prints plus a digital copy.
